Blog

screenshot of Blog

Obsidian笔记库 | 我的笔记分bei享fen | 根据GitHub工作流自动构建vitepress博客

Overview

在我个人的知识管理过程中,我决定将我的笔记从有道云笔记迁移到Obsidian,以便更好地整理和可视化我的信息。而在安装Obsidian后,我进一步配置了VitePress与GitHub Pages,利用GitHub Actions自动生成我的博客网站。这一系列创新的组合,极大地提升了我的工作效率和写作体验。

通过将笔记存储在Obsidian与自动化的博客生成和部署流程相结合,我找到了一个既灵活又高效的方式来管理我的知识。这种方法不仅避免了在Obsidian中打开过多文件造成的卡顿,还让我能够轻松地更新和维护我的网站。

Features

  • Obsidian笔记管理:提供强大的个人笔记存储与组织功能,支持Markdown格式,极大提升写作和整理的灵活性。
  • VitePress集成:轻量级的静态网站生成器,确保博客的快速构建和部署,便于即时更新内容。
  • GitHub Pages部署:借助GitHub Pages将网站托管在线,使得每次push都能自动同步到线上,简化了发布流程。
  • 自动化工作流:通过GitHub Actions实现自动构建和部署,减少手动操作,提升工作效率。
  • 文件隔离机制:将VitePress相关文件隔离存储,防止Obsidian打开大量文件时造成的系统卡顿,保持软件运行流畅。
  • VSCode插件开发:针对特定需求开发的插件,提升个人化使用体验,可以获取AI训练所需的语料。
  • 油猴脚本支持:提供灵活的自定义脚本功能,进一步扩大功能边界,满足个人特定需求。